FNSKU Labels: The Foundation of Amazon Product Identification

FNSKU (Fulfillment Network Stock Keeping Unit) labels are at the core of Amazon's product identification system. These labels are unique to each seller and product combination, allowing Amazon to accurately track and manage inventory within their fulfillment network.

Key Points About FNSKU Labels:

  • Required for every product sold on Amazon FBA
  • Assigned by Amazon to identify products as unique to the seller
  • Must be applied to each individual product
  • Can be substituted by manufacturer barcodes if registered with Amazon

How to Obtain and Apply FNSKU Labels

  1. Log in to your Amazon Seller Central account
  2. Navigate to the "Inventory" tab and select "Manage FBA Inventory"
  3. Choose the product(s) you need labels for
  4. Click on "Print Item Labels"
  5. Download and print the labels
  6. Apply the labels to each individual product

It's important to note that while FNSKU labels are mandatory, sellers can register their manufacturer barcodes with Amazon to use them in place of FNSKU labels. This can be particularly useful for products that already have UPC or EAN codes printed on them.

FBA Carton Labels: Ensuring Smooth Delivery to Amazon Fulfillment Centers

FBA carton labels are essential for the efficient processing of your shipments at Amazon fulfillment centers. These labels contain crucial information that helps Amazon receive and process your inventory accurately.

Key Points About FBA Carton Labels:

  • Generated through the Amazon Seller Central account
  • Unique to each shipment and fulfillment center
  • Must be applied to each carton in the shipment
  • Critical for shipments split between multiple fulfillment centers

Best Practices for FBA Carton Labeling

  1. Generate labels through Amazon Seller Central before shipping
  2. Send FBA carton labels to your supplier for labeling at origin when possible
  3. Ensure each carton is labeled with the correct FBA label, especially for split shipments
  4. If suppliers cannot label at origin, mark cartons with the Amazon SKU
  5. For FCL (Full Container Load) shipments, labels must be applied at origin to avoid transloading

It's important to note that if your shipment is split between multiple fulfillment centers, each portion of the shipment will have a unique FBA ID and corresponding label. Accuracy in applying these labels is crucial to prevent misrouting and delays.

LTL Pallet Labels: Optimizing Large Shipments to Amazon

For sellers using Less Than Truckload (LTL) shipping to Amazon, pallet labels are an additional requirement. These labels ensure that palletized shipments are correctly identified and routed within Amazon's fulfillment network.

Key Points About LTL Pallet Labels:

  • Required for Amazon LTL and some third-party LTL shipments
  • Applied after palletization, often at a warehouse or distribution center
  • Generated through Amazon Seller Central
  • Essential for accurate routing and processing of palletized shipments

FCL Shipping: Palletized vs. Floor-Loaded Options

For sellers shipping Full Container Loads (FCL) to Amazon, there are two primary options for cargo packaging: palletized and floor-loaded. Each option has its own considerations and labeling requirements.

Palletized FCL Shipments:

  • Requires pallet labels to be applied at origin
  • Easier for Amazon to unload and process
  • May result in less damage to products during transit
  • Reduces the volume of cargo that can fit in a container

Floor-Loaded FCL Shipments:

  • Maximizes container space utilization
  • Requires careful stacking and securing of cartons
  • May require more time and labor to unload at Amazon fulfillment centers
  • Still requires proper FBA carton labeling

The choice between palletized and floor-loaded FCL shipments depends on various factors, including product type, quantity, and shipping costs. Special Considerations and Common Pitfalls

While understanding the basic labeling requirements is crucial, there are several special considerations and common pitfalls that Amazon FBA sellers should be aware of:

1. Manufacturer Barcode Registration

If you choose to use manufacturer barcodes (UPC, EAN) instead of FNSKU labels, ensure that you properly register these barcodes with Amazon. Failure to do so can result in inventory tracking issues and potential account suspensions.

2. Label Quality and Placement

Ensure that all labels are of high quality, clearly printed, and properly affixed to products and cartons. Poor quality or improperly placed labels can lead to scanning errors and processing delays.

3. Split Shipments

When dealing with split shipments (shipments divided between multiple fulfillment centers), pay extra attention to applying the correct FBA carton labels. Mixing up labels can result in inventory being sent to the wrong fulfillment center.

4. Labeling at Origin vs. Destination

Whenever possible, have FBA carton labels applied at the origin (e.g., by your supplier). This is especially critical for FCL shipments, as labeling at the destination may require costly transloading services.

5. Commingled Inventory

If you participate in Amazon's commingled inventory program, be aware that this may affect your labeling requirements. Consult with Amazon or a logistics expert to understand how commingled inventory impacts your specific labeling needs.
